Schlossgut Diel de Diel Trocken 2012

$35.50

Tasting Notes: Apple and sweet corn mingled with brightly juicy lime point strongly toward the wine’s share of Pinot Blanc, and there is even a bit of that grape’s natural creaminess on the palate. The finish is generously juicy, and subtle suggestions of apple seeds and stone add interest.

Region: Dorsheim, Germany

Alcohol: 12.5%

Description

This exceptional dry white wine was first created in 1994 for the Business Class of Lufthansa and has now become the distinctive “business card” of Schlossgut Diel. It perfectly combines the difference in characters of the grape varieties involved in this special cuvée: while the Pinot Gris shows abundance and spice and the Pinot Blanc plays the elegant part, the Riesling provides the invigorating freshness. A wonderfully refreshing wine, which gives a lot of pleasure while drinking.

HARVEST

A selective handpicking of Grapes from our own vineyards

GRAPE VARIETIES

  • 70% Riesling
  • 20% Grauburgunder
  • 10% Weißburgunder

WINEMAKING

Carefully pressing of the whole grapes. Fermentation and storage are in stainless steel tanks and wood barrels made of oak from the local forest.

FOOD PAIRING

The perfect Apéritif! Pairs also well with many appetizers, seafood and poultry.

IDEAL TIME TO DRINK

Two to six years after bottling.
